Autor | Zpráva | ||
---|---|---|---|
pat Profil * |
#1 · Zasláno: 14. 4. 2010, 15:02:11
Dobrý den, chci se zeptat co dělám špatně. Děkuju
$date = strtotime("+13 year", $ted); echo date("Y-m-d H:i:s", $date); Výsledek je: 1983-01-01 01:33:30 |
||
pat Profil * |
#2 · Zasláno: 14. 4. 2010, 15:04:27
Jen chci ještě dodat, že proměná ted neni prázdná, ale s dnešním datumem. Proč mi to tedy vypisuje špatně?
|
||
Taps Profil |
#3 · Zasláno: 14. 4. 2010, 15:10:20
pat:
zkus to jednodušeji echo date("Y-m-d H:i:s", strtotime("+13 year")); |
||
pat Profil * |
#4 · Zasláno: 14. 4. 2010, 15:15:45
Jednodušeji to maká, ale kde byl tedy problém? Je to stejné jen já to vleču po kusech.
|
||
blaaablaaa Profil |
#5 · Zasláno: 14. 4. 2010, 15:30:21
A byla promenna $ted ve spravnem formatu (timestamp)?
|
||
Taps Profil |
#6 · Zasláno: 14. 4. 2010, 15:31:27
pat:
podívej se jak máš zapsanou funkci strtotime |
||
pat Profil * |
#7 · Zasláno: 14. 4. 2010, 15:32:03
Byla jsem si jí vypisoval i téměř pod lupou zkoumal. Proto nechápu, kde byla ta chyba.
|
||
pat Profil * |
#8 · Zasláno: 14. 4. 2010, 15:37:43
Sice mě to bude vrtat hlavou ještě dlouho, ale podstatný je, že to fachá. :-) Děkuju
|
||
nightfish Profil |
#9 · Zasláno: 14. 4. 2010, 15:59:32
pat:
když místo kódu v [#1] použiješ var_dump($ted); $date = strtotime("+13 year", $ted); echo date("Y-m-d H:i:s", $date); tak to vypíše co? |
||
Časová prodleva: 16 let
|
0